The cheapest way to get from Wool to Monkey World is to taxi which costs £9 - £11 and takes 3 min.
The fastest way to get from Wool to Monkey World is to taxi which takes 3 min and costs £9 - £11.
Yes, there is a direct bus departing from Wool Station station and arriving at Monkey World Car Park. Services depart every 30 minutes, and operate every day. The journey takes approximately 15 min.
The distance between Wool and Monkey World is 4 miles.
The best way to get from Wool to Monkey World without a car is to line 55 bus which takes 16 min and costs .
The line 55 bus from Wool Station to Monkey World Car Park takes 15 min including transfers and departs every 30 minutes.
Wool to Monkey World bus services, operated by First in Wessex Dorset & South Somerset, depart from Wool Station.
